Cannot get a clean flash to install correctly regardless of ROM topic






So this is bugging me out. I received my Verizon Dev Edition last week. It came with NJ5 already installed, so I skipped the first step to flash custom recovery, and then I rooted. Everything is great I have a rooted stock NJ5 ROM with a custom recovery. Now when I wipe my data, system, dalvik, and cache (clean install) to install any rom (Definitive/FireKat) I get a Amazon Kindle unfortunate force close error at the start up wizard, also the samsung keyboard swipe feature and suggestions at the top do not work at all. After I let it settle I bypass the wizard by pressing skip, then I turn off auto sync. I log in to google and I try to launch Maps and I get a force close error. I tried updating it in the Play Store and it gets a download error. What is going on?? I am going kind of insane trying to fix this. I ODIN Stock NJ5 restore to get maps, kindle, and the keyboard to work correctly. I spent all day trying to figure this and I can not for the life of me get a good solid flash! I am thinking of ODINing Stock NI1 Restore to see what happens. Will I break my phone if I downgrade? Does anybody have any suggestions to fix these errors? It is only when I flash a ROM from TWRP.
